STM32H562RGT6 by STMicroelectronics

STM32H562RGT6 by STMicroelectronics is a 32-bit microcontroller with Cortex-M33 CPU family. It features 22 timers, 16-ch ADC, and 2-ch DAC for versatile applications in IoT, industrial automation, and consumer electronics. With a clock frequency of up to 50 MHz and low power mode support, it offers high performance and energy efficiency.

STMicroelectronics

STMicroelectronics is a global leader in the semiconductor manufacturing industry, with over 35 years of experience providing innovative and advanced technologies for customers around the world. Headquartered in Netherlands, STMicroelectronics has more than 51,323 employees worldwide and operates across 32 countries all over Europe, Asia-Pacific and the Americas. The company’s portfolio includes integrated circuits, discrete components, application-specific standard products, and computer chipsets. STMicroelectronics serves a wide range of industries such as automotive, consumer markets, healthcare and industrial applications.
